How to prepare for a job interview at iPipeline
✨Know Your Business Analysis Basics
Brush up on your business analysis fundamentals. Be ready to discuss how you've gathered requirements in past projects and the methodologies you've used. This will show that you have a solid foundation and can hit the ground running.
✨Showcase Your Problem-Solving Skills
Prepare specific examples of challenges you've faced in previous roles and how you tackled them.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ers. This will demonstrate your analytical thinking and problem-solving mindset.
✨Communicate Like a Pro
Since effective communication with stakeholders is key, practice articulating your thoughts clearly and concisely. Consider doing mock interviews with a friend or mentor to refine your delivery and ensure you can convey complex ideas simply.
